Abstract Current research of automatic transmission (AT) mainly focuses on the improvement of driving performance, and configuration innovation is one of the main research directions. However, finding new configurations of ATs is one of the main limitations of configuration innovation. In the present study, epicyclic gear trains (EGTs) are applied to investigate mechanisms of 9-speed ATs. Then four kinematic configurations are proposed for automatic transitions. In order to evaluate the performance of proposed mechanisms, the lever analogy method is applied to conduct kinematic and mechanical analyses. The power flow analysis is conducted, and then transmission efficiencies are calculated based on the torque method. The comparative analysis between the proposed and existing mechanisms is carried out where obtained results show that proposed mechanisms have reasonable performance and can be used in ATs. The prototype of an AT is manufactured and the speed test is conducted, which proves the accuracy of analysis and the feasibility of proposed mechanisms.
